AI Summary

  • Establishes a 10% sales tax on the sale of video games rated "mature"
  • Requires tax revenue to be directed to the Department of Mental Health and Addiction Services
  • Mandates use of collected funds to develop educational materials for families about video game addiction and antisocial behavior warning signs
  • Referred to the Committee on Public Health during the January 2013 legislative session
  • Introduced by Representative Hovey, 112th District

Legislative Description

An Act Establishing A Sales Tax On Certain Video Games.
